Dan Patch Bowling Lanes, Ottawa Avenue, Savage, Minnesota opened its doors in 1956 and closed in 2007. This is now the site of Guild Residential Treatment Services.

Panoramic view of Railroad Street and Third Avenue at the North Hibbing town site, after the removal of buildings to the South Hibbing town site. Prominent building in center is the Oliver Hotel, which was located at 422 3rd Avenue, Hibbing, Minnesota. Also visible is the abandoned band shell or pavilion in Mesaba Park (at right).

Panoramic view of Remington Yards Building Material area and surrounding area to include track workers, oil storage tank farm, warehouse buildings, Great Northern Freight Cars, Southern Pacific Railroad Car, gondola railroad cars and a bus. Photograph is undated but presumed to be taken in the 1920s era. Remington Yards was located at 1218 3rd Avenue in North Hibbing, Minnesota.
